Passing the road test
The road test is a crucial step towards becoming a professional motorist. To ensure that you're ready for the driving test, it is important to be prepared in advance. There are many ways to do this, such as taking a driver's ed class or getting behind-the-wheel training with a professional driving instructor. Regardless of how you prepare, it's essential to keep in mind that the driver examiner is looking for safety and competence, not perfection. The following tips will increase your chances of passing the test and becoming a safe driver.
Be familiar with the area you will be testing prior to taking the test. This will allow you to learn about the traffic patterns and hazards in the area. Make sure your vehicle is in good working order and has all the necessary equipment to drive safely. This includes lights and mirrors. You might also want to carry a spare tire, jumper cables, and flashlight in case you have to change a flat or be stuck on the side of the road.
There are two kinds of pre-licensing classes that are classroom and distance learning. Classroom courses are offered by high schools as well as some private driving schools. Students must be 16 years old or older to enroll in the classroom pre-licensing classes. The virtual classroom/distance learning course is also offered by certain high schools, colleges and some private driving schools. This kind of course is designed for people who cannot attend traditional classes, and offers the same educational experience. Both types of courses are approved by the DMV and come with an MV-278 Pre-licensing Course Completion Certificate which is required to schedule your road test.

The Complete Drivers Education Program, a state-approved program, helps you pass your New York State Driver's Exam and get the Learner Permit. The program integrates classroom and driving instruction. The classroom portion of the program is comprised of nine two-hour classes that include lectures, video tutorials and a variety of learning exercises. The hands-on component of the course comprises 6 hours of instruction in the behind-the-wheel (three two-hour sessions), and optionally 6 hours of observation.
Many driving schools and high-school courses offer an online version of this class. This option is convenient, flexible and allows students to work at their own pace. It can also be used to earn a high school elective credit and is very affordable.
